Step-by-Step Vegetable Prep
1. Selecting Fresh Vegetables
The key to excellent sushi rolls lies in the freshness of the ingredients. Choose vibrant and firm vegetables such as cucumbers, bell peppers, avocados, carrots, and radishes. Aim for organic where possible for the best flavor and nutrition.
2. Precision Cutting
Cutting your vegetables to the right size is vital. Ideally, vegetables should be julienned (cut into thin matchstick-like strips) to ensure a uniform texture and appearance. Here are a few tips:
- Cucumbers: Halve them, scoop out the seeds, and slice them into thin strips.
- Carrots: Peel and julienne finely. A mandoline slicer can help achieve uniform cuts.
- Avocados: Slice lengthwise, remove the pit, and cut into long strips.
- Bell Peppers: Remove seeds and slice thinly.
3. Keeping Vegetables Crisp
Submerge your cut vegetables in ice water for about 10 minutes. This step will not only keep them crisp but will also enhance their natural colors, lending your sushi rolls a vibrant, appealing appearance.
4. Assembling the Sushi Roll
Lay your nori (seaweed) sheet on a bamboo mat. Spread an even layer of sushi rice, taking care to leave a margin at the top. Arrange your prepared vegetables in the center. Roll your sushi tightly, using the mat to assist.
